当前位置: 首页 > news >正文

网站开发类论文wordpress 嵌入视频

网站开发类论文,wordpress 嵌入视频,如何制作个人作品网站,申请备案网站首页以下内容源于网络资源的整理#xff0c;如有侵权请告知删除。 一、文件系统 文件系统是对一个存储设备上的数据进行组织的机制。这种机制有利于用户和操作系统的交互。 尽管内核是 Linux 的核心#xff0c;但文件却是用户与操作系统交互所采用的主要工具。对Linux来说尤其如…以下内容源于网络资源的整理如有侵权请告知删除。 一、文件系统 文件系统是对一个存储设备上的数据进行组织的机制。这种机制有利于用户和操作系统的交互。 尽管内核是 Linux 的核心但文件却是用户与操作系统交互所采用的主要工具。对Linux来说尤其如此因为UNIX使用文件I/O机制管理硬件设备和数据文件。在Linux中如果没有文件系统用户和操作系统的交互也就断开了。 用户空间包含一些应用程序和 GNU C 库(glibc)它们为文件系统调用(文件的打开、读取、写和关闭)提供用户接口。 系统调用接口的作用就像是交换器它将系统调用从用户空间发送到内核空间中的适当端点。 VFS 是底层文件系统的主要接口。 这个组件导出一组接口然后将它们抽象到各个文件系统各个文件系统的行为可能差异很大。有两个针对文件系统对象的缓存(inode 和 dentry)。它们缓存最近使用过的文件系统对象。每个文件系统实现(比如 ext2、JFS 等等)导出一组通用接口供 VFS 使用。缓冲区缓存会缓存文件系统和相关块设备之间的请求。例如对底层设备驱动程序的读写请求会通过缓冲区缓存来传递。这就允许在其中缓存请求减少访问物理设备的次数加快访问速度。以最近使用(LRU)列表的形式管理缓冲区缓存。注意可以使用 sync 命令将缓冲区缓存中的请求发送到存储媒体(迫使所有未写的数据发送到设备驱动程序进而发送到存储设备)。二、根文件系统 当我们在Windows环境下提到文件系统时首先想到的是Fat32、NTFS等文件系统类型而在Linux中则会想到Ext2、Ext3等文件系统。但其实还有一种很重要的文件系统——根文件系统。 根文件系统首先它是一种文件系统该文件系统不仅具有普通文件系统的存储数据文件的功能而且相对于普通的文件系统它的特殊之处在于它是内核启动时所挂载的第一个文件系统内核代码的映像文件保存在根文件系统中在根文件系统成功挂载之后系统引导启动程序会从中把一些初始化脚本(如rcSinittab)和服务加载到内存中去运行。 那么根文件系统是怎样挂载的呢先将/dev/ram0挂载而后执行/linuxrc等其执行完后切换到根目录再挂载具体的根文件系统。根文件系挂载之后也就是到了Start_kernel()函数的最后执行init进程也就第一个用户进程对系统进行各种初始化的操作。 根文件系统之所以在前面加一个”根“说明它是加载其它文件系统的“根”它包含系统引导和使其他文件系统得以挂载所必需的文件。根文件系统包括Linux启动时所必需的目录和关键性文件例如Linux启动时都需要有init目录下的相关文件在 Linux挂载分区时Linux一定会找/etc/fstab这个文件根文件系统中还包括了许多的应用程序bin目录等。任何包括这些Linux 系统启动所必须的文件都可以成为根文件系统。 Linux启动时第一个必须挂载的是根文件系统。如果系统不能从指定设备上挂载根文件系统则系统会出错而退出启动。成功之后可以自动或手动挂载其他的文件系统。因此一个系统可以同时存在不同的文件系统。在 Linux 中将一个文件系统与一个存储设备关联起来的过程称为挂装(mount)。使用mount命令可以将一个文件系统附着到当前文件系统层次结构中。在执行挂装时要提供文件系统类型、文件系统和一个挂装点。根文件系统被挂载到根目录后在根目录下就有根文件系统的各个目录与文件/bin、/sbin、 /mnt等再将其他分区挂接到/mnt目录上/mnt目录下就有这个分区的各个目录与文件。 附录 Linux支持多种文件系统包括 ext2、ext3、vfat、ntfs、iso9660、jffs、romfs、cramfs、nfs 等。为了统一管理Linux引入虚拟文件系统 VFSVirtual FILE System。 Linux 文件系统由 4 层组成分别是用户层、内核层、驱动层、和硬件层。 用户层为用户提供一个操作接口。 内核层实现了各种文件系统。 驱动层是块设备的驱动程序。 硬件层是嵌入式系统使用的几种存储器。 Linux启动时第一个必须挂载的是  根文件系统。 嵌入式系统的存储介质 JFFS文件系统主要用于NOR型Flash存储器。其基于MTD驱动层。可读写、支持数据压缩、基于哈希表的日志型文件系统并提供了崩溃掉电安全保护提供“写平衡”支持。 YAFFS文件系统专门为NAND Flash存储器设计的嵌入式文件系统。适用于大容量的存储设备。速度快占用内存少不支持压缩和只支持NAND Flash存储器。 根文件系统 ​​​​​​​ 根文件系统被存储在Flash存储器中存储器被分为多个分区分区1分区2分区3等。 分区1一般存储Linux内核映像文件分区2存放根文件系统根文件系统中存放着系统启动必须的文件和程序包括提供用户界面的shell程序、应用程序依赖的库、配置文件等。 内核启动后运行的第一个程序是init其将启动根文件系统中的shell程序给用户提供一个友好的操作界面。 构建根文件系统 第一种方法下载相应的命令源码并移植到处理器架构平台上。 第二种方法使用开源工具构建。BusyBox、TinyLogin、Embutils
http://www.zqtcl.cn/news/857887/

相关文章:

  • 网站开发版本号正规的企业网站建设公司
  • 中国做网站正邦温州网站建设方案服务
  • 南通网站关键词优化wordpress做小程序
  • 上海企业网站seo多少钱做网站图片链接到天猫
  • 属于教育主管部门建设的专题资源网站是广西壮锦网站建设策划书
  • 云南网站制作一条龙网站建设公司对比分析报告
  • 手机网站客户端网站语言有几种
  • 做网站怎么选取关键词中企动力销售陪酒多吗
  • 新网站做内链雅虎网站收录提交入口
  • 简述建设一个网站的具体过程接做名片的网站
  • 怎样建立自己网站网站产品数据如何恢复
  • 用wordpress建立电商网站用Off做网站
  • 网站建设公司不赚钱ui设计软件培训学校
  • 网站项目策划书模板wordpress修改模版
  • 房地产手机网站模板电脑建立网站
  • 网站自适应手机代码网络服务机构的网站
  • 系统网站重庆智能建站模板
  • wordpress适合优化吗宝塔 wordpress优化
  • 怎么利用网站做外链接怎样做公司网站介绍
  • 广州网站优化渠道木门网站模板
  • 手机网站菜单设计wordpress加联系方式
  • 网站管理助手怎么使用多种郑州网站建设
  • 汉中网站建设费用外贸网站服务商
  • 苏宿工业园区网站建设成功案例色流网站如何做
  • 北沙滩网站建设公司电子商务网站建设管理论文
  • 公司备案证查询网站查询系统网页设计html代码大全及含义
  • 成都开发网站建设做网站一般会出现的问题
  • 企业网站设计布局方式如何在社交网站上做视频推广方案
  • 惠城网站建设服务做1688网站需要懂英语吗
  • 请人做网站要多少钱搜索引擎优化概述